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$2,845 per month in Asker vs $1,716 in Medellin, rent included.

A couple spends around $4,037 per month in Asker vs $2,527 in Medellin, rent included.

A family of three spends $5,229 per month in Asker vs $3,338 in Medellin, rent included.

Asker costs about 66% more than Medellin, driven mainly by Eating Out.

Both Asker and Medellin sit above the global median – Asker by 107%, Medellin by 25%.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$1,532 in Asker versus $1,060 in Medellin.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 496% higher in Asker,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$63.0 in Asker versus $48.00 in Medellin.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$362 vs $303 – making Medellin the more affordable choice for daily food spending.

Asker vs Medellin: Cost of Living - Frequently Asked Questions
Which city is more expensive, Asker or Medellin?
Asker costs about 66% more than Medellin, with the gap driven mainly by Eating Out. That's enough to noticeably affect everyday spending and lifestyle for anyone choosing between the two.
How much do you need to earn to live comfortably in Asker and in Medellin?
For a comfortable life, plan on about $4,268 per month in Asker and $2,574 in Medellin. That covers rent, food, utilities, transport, and enough left over to feel settled – not just surviving.
Where is rent cheaper, Asker or Medellin?
Rent is clearly cheaper in Medellin, especially for central apartments. Housing is actually the single biggest factor behind the overall cost gap between these two cities.
How do childcare costs compare in Asker and in Medellin?
Kindergarten costs $248 per month in Asker and $793 in Medellin. For families with young kids, this one expense can tip the scales when choosing between the two cities.
Are groceries more expensive in Asker or in Medellin?
Groceries cost about 19% more in Asker, though it depends on what you buy. Local produce may be comparable; imported and premium items show the biggest price gap.
Can you live on $2,500/month in Asker or in Medellin?
A $2,500 monthly budget goes further in Medellin, where all-in costs run around $1,716, than in Asker at $2,845. In Medellin it covers expenses comfortably, while in Asker it requires careful planning or may not stretch far enough.
